Windows 7 computer. Latest version of VLC Media Player installed. Latest version of VLC Remote on my iPhone. Router is a Linksys E3000.

I sat down tonight to use VLC remote for the first time since the latest version was released. It wouldn't connect. On the local computer, I can browse to localhost:8080 and the VLC interface shows up in the web browser. When I try to browse to the machine from another device (PC, iPad, whatever), I get this:

403 Forbidden (/)
-------------------------
VideoLAN [link to website]

I've disabled the Windows firewall to no avail (there's no other firewall installed). I've searched the router config and can't find anything that would be preventing the traffic. The fact that the 403 page has a link to VideoLAN makes me think that VLC itself is preventing the connection.

This worked with the previous version of VLC and VLC Remote. Can anybody suggest what else I might try?

handful of things here:

the 403 error means that you need to update the .hosts file
see the manual setup instructions for how to do that
